Chamishi
- Yosef in Mitzrayim:
- Potifar, the head butcher of Pharaoh, had purchased Yosef from the Yishmaeilim who brought him there.
- Hashem blesses the home of Potifar: Hashem was with Yosef, and Yosef was successful while at the home of his master the Egyptian. His master noticed his success and that G-d is with him. As a result, Yosef found favor in his eyes, and was placed in charge of everything in the home. After Yosef was appointed in charge of the estate, and all of his assets, Hashem blessed the house of the Egyptian due to Yosef, and blessing was found in everything in the home and field. Yosef was placed in charge of everything, aside for the bread which he eats. Yosef had a beautiful figure and appearance.
Q&A from Rashi
Q1: Why does the Torah return to Yosef’s story after the Judah-Tamar episode?
A: Rashi explains that the Torah interrupts Yosef’s narrative to juxtapose Judah’s demotion with Yosef’s sale, showing that Judah lost his status because of his role in the sale. Another reason: to place Potiphar’s wife’s story next to Tamar’s, teaching that both acted “for the sake of heaven”—Tamar knowingly, and Potiphar’s wife mistakenly, thinking she would bear Yosef’s descendants.
Q2: What does “וְיוֹסֵף הוּרַד” (Yosef had been taken down) imply?
A: It signals a return to the original subject after the digression about Judah.
Q3: What does “כִּי ה’ אִתּוֹ” (that G-d was with him) mean?
A: Rashi explains that G-d’s name was constantly on Yosef’s lips, showing his faith.
Q4: What does “וְכָל־יֶשׁ־לוֹ” (all he owned) indicate?
A: It’s an abbreviated phrase; the word אֲשֶׁר (“that”) is omitted after וְכָל.
Q5: Why does the Torah say Potiphar “did not concern himself with anything except the bread he ate”?
A: Rashi says “bread” is a euphemism for his wife. Potiphar entrusted everything to Yosef except his wife.
Q6: Why mention Yosef’s beauty here?
A: Rashi explains that once Yosef gained control of the household, he began grooming himself. G-d rebuked him: “Your father is mourning, and you are grooming your hair! I will incite the bear against you”—hinting at Potiphar’s wife’s coming temptation.
